Uniswap Exchange | Liquidity Pools and Token Swaps - us
Uniswap has revolutionized decentralized trading, providing users with a seamless and permissionless platform for exchanging ERC-20 tokens.
Last updated
Uniswap has revolutionized decentralized trading, providing users with a seamless and permissionless platform for exchanging ERC-20 tokens.
Last updated
Uniswap has gained widespread recognition as a decentralized exchange (DEX) built on the Ethereum blockchain, enabling users to swap various ERC-20 tokens directly. As a key player in the decentralized finance (DeFi) ecosystem, Uniswap offers users a unique and decentralized trading experience. This guide explores the features, benefits, and potential challenges associated with using the Uniswap exchange.
Understanding Uniswap:
Uniswap operates on the principle of automated market making (AMM), using liquidity pools to facilitate token swaps. Unlike traditional exchanges that rely on order books, Uniswap relies on liquidity pools created by users who contribute their assets to the platform. These pools consist of two tokens paired together, allowing users to trade between them at a dynamically determined exchange rate.
Key Features of Uniswap:
Decentralization: Uniswap is built on the Ethereum blockchain, providing a decentralized and censorship-resistant trading platform. Users have complete control over their funds without the need for a central authority.
Liquidity Pools: Users can provide liquidity to Uniswap by depositing an equal value of two tokens into a liquidity pool. In return, they receive liquidity provider (LP) tokens representing their share of the pool. Liquidity providers earn fees from trades and a portion of the trading fees goes to the LPs.
Token Swaps: Uniswap allows users to swap ERC-20 tokens directly through its intuitive interface. The exchange rate is determined by a mathematical formula that adjusts based on the ratio of tokens in the liquidity pool.
Permissionless Listing: Unlike centralized exchanges that require a vetting process for listing tokens, Uniswap allows anyone to create a trading pair by contributing an equal value of both tokens to a liquidity pool.
Using Uniswap:
Connecting to a Wallet: To use Uniswap, users need to connect their Ethereum wallet to the platform. Commonly used wallets include MetaMask and Trust Wallet. Ensure that your wallet is funded with the tokens you want to trade.
Accessing Pools: Navigate to the "Pools" section on the Uniswap interface. Here, you can explore existing liquidity pools or create a new pool by adding tokens and contributing liquidity.
Swapping Tokens: To swap tokens, go to the "Swap" tab and select the tokens you want to trade. Uniswap will display the estimated amount you'll receive based on the current exchange rate. Confirm the transaction through your connected wallet.
Challenges and Considerations:
Impermanent Loss: Liquidity providers may face impermanent loss, a temporary loss of funds caused by fluctuations in the token prices within a liquidity pool.
Gas Fees: As Uniswap operates on the Ethereum network, users may encounter high gas fees during times of network congestion, impacting the cost-effectiveness of smaller trades.
Smart Contract Risks: While Uniswap has undergone extensive audits, users should be cautious and only interact with verified smart contracts to minimize the risk of potential vulnerabilities.
Conclusion:
Uniswap has revolutionized decentralized trading, providing users with a seamless and permissionless platform for exchanging ERC-20 tokens. As with any financial platform, users should exercise caution, be aware of associated risks, and stay informed about the latest developments in the rapidly evolving DeFi space. By understanding the features and considerations outlined in this guide, users can navigate the Uniswap exchange confidently and participate in the decentralized finance revolution.